Public Employees Retirement Association (PERA)

     We are proud to have State Treasurer Walker Stapleton supporting and advising our campaign.  Walker has taken a lead on diffusing this ticking time bomb for taxpayers.  Our government employee pension is in trouble.  Estimates state that PERA is somewhere between a $21 billion and $41 billion dollar unfunded liability.  To put this in perspective, our entire state budget is $20 billion.  Self interested individuals have been overseeing PERA, and have been doling out unsustainable benefits, including early retirement at a significant portion of the retirees salary.  In November of 2011, PERA was still counting on an 8% return, and this is completely unrealistic.

Three Short-term Fixes For PERA:

  1.  Change the make-up of the PERA Board from PERA enrollees to actual financial professionals that don’t have a self-interest.
  2. Change the benefits, and raise the retirement age for PERA (again).
  3. Switch from a defined benefits plan (You are guaranteed X amount of dollars when you retire at age X), to a defined contribution plan (you contribute part of your salary, and the market will dictate what you get when you retire).
